Abstract
FloSafe is a self-contained, automated, water quality assurance system. Chemical content in water affects many different fields of interest such as drinking water, hot tubs, swimming pools, and fish tanks. FloSafe is a general open-ended technology that monitors and controls the chemical content in water. The first application using FloSafe technology is a hot tub water chemistry balancer. FloSafe will eliminate the need to test and retest your hot tub before going in for a nice warm bath. With virtually no user interaction, the hot tub water chemistry balancer keeps your hot tub's chemicals at the appropriate usage levels.

Description
Undergraduate Engineering students are required to complete a group-based, two-course capstone sequence: ENSC 405W and ENSC 440.  Groups form company structures and create an innovative product that potentially acts as a solution to a real-life problem.  This collection archives the following assignments: proposal, design specifications, requirements specifications, and proof of concept.
